The Correct Fan Direction for Summer Explained Clearly
In summer, a ceiling fan should rotate counterclockwise when viewed from below. This direction pushes air downward, creating a direct breeze across the skin. That breeze increases evaporation of perspiration and improves convective heat loss, making the body feel cooler almost immediately.

If you stand beneath your fan and feel air blowing straight down, the fan direction is set correctly for summer. If the air seems to pull upward instead, the direction needs to be reversed.
Why Counterclockwise Fan Direction Works in Summer
The effectiveness of fan direction summer settings is rooted in basic thermodynamics and human physiology. Moving air accelerates heat transfer from the body to the surrounding environment. When airflow passes over skin, it disrupts the insulating layer of warm air that naturally forms around the body, replacing it with cooler air.
According to guidance from the U.S. Department of Energy, proper fan use can allow homeowners to raise thermostat settings by several degrees without sacrificing comfort. This combination of airflow and higher thermostat settings leads to significant energy savings during summer months.
How to Tell If Your Fan Is Spinning the Right Way
Most ceiling fans include a small switch on the motor housing that controls blade direction. Before adjusting it, the fan should always be turned off completely. Once restarted, observe the blade motion from below. In summer, the blades should move from the top left to the top right, creating a downward airflow.
Newer fans may use remote controls or wall-mounted panels instead of physical switches. In these cases, the reverse function is typically labeled or represented by circular arrows.

Fan Direction Summer Compared to Winter Settings
Ceiling fans are designed for year-round use, but their purpose changes with the seasons. In winter, fans rotate clockwise at low speed to pull cool air upward and gently push warm air down from the ceiling without creating a breeze. In summer, that same clockwise motion works against comfort by reducing airflow where people actually are.
Switching fan direction seasonally is a simple habit that delivers consistent comfort benefits throughout the year.

Choosing the Right Fan Speed for Summer Comfort
While direction is the most critical factor, speed also plays a role. Higher speeds move more air, increasing the cooling effect. In most living spaces during summer, medium to high fan speeds offer the best balance between comfort and noise.
Bedrooms often benefit from slightly lower speeds at night to prevent drafts or excessive dryness, while larger common areas typically require higher airflow to feel comfortable during the day.

Why Fan Size and Blade Design Matter in Summer
Not all ceiling fans perform equally. Larger rooms require larger fans to move sufficient air volume. Blade pitch also affects performance; steeper blade angles typically move air more efficiently, enhancing the cooling effect.

Common Misunderstandings About Fan Direction in Summer
One of the most persistent myths is that ceiling fans cool empty rooms. In reality, fans should always be turned off when no one is present, as they only cool people through direct airflow.
Another misconception is that fan direction does not matter. In fact, incorrect direction can reduce airflow effectiveness or counteract cooling efforts entirely.
Some people believe running fans continuously is beneficial, but unnecessary operation wastes electricity without providing comfort benefits.
Fan Direction Summer in Different Climates
In humid climates, airflow is especially effective because it accelerates evaporation, making fans feel dramatically cooling. In dry climates, fans still improve comfort by increasing convective heat loss, even though the sensation may feel slightly different.
Regardless of climate, the correct fan direction summer setting remains counterclockwise for optimal comfort.

Maintaining Your Fan for Peak Summer Performance
Dust buildup on fan blades reduces airflow efficiency and can contribute to poor indoor air quality. Regular cleaning improves performance and comfort. Balanced blades also matter, as wobbling fans move less air and consume more energy.
Older fans may require occasional lubrication, while newer models are typically maintenance-free.
